What is Workplace Diversity?
Workplace diversity encompasses the range of differences among individuals in an organization. These differences can include, but are not limited to, race, gender, age, sexual orientation, disability, and cultural differences. A diverse workplace values each individual's unique contributions and perspectives, fostering an inclusive environment where everyone feels valued and empowered.
Importance of Workplace Diversity in Pretoria
In Pretoria, embracing diversity is essential for various reasons:
- Enhanced Creativity and Innovation: Diverse teams bring a wealth of different viewpoints and ideas, driving creativity and leading to innovative solutions.
- Improved Employee Satisfaction: An inclusive workplace fosters a supportive environment, leading to higher employee morale and retention rates.
- Better Decision-Making: A mix of perspectives can lead to more informed decision-making processes and solutions that cater to a broader audience.
- Attracting Talent: Diverse organizations tend to attract a wider range of candidates, enhancing the talent pool and ensuring a fit with various markets.
Strategies for Promoting Workplace Diversity
Organizations in Pretoria can take several steps to promote diversity within their workplaces:
- Implement Inclusive Recruitment Practices: Review your hiring processes to eliminate biases and ensure that job postings reach diverse groups.
- Offer Training and Education: Educate employees about the importance of diversity and inclusion through workshops and training sessions.
- Encourage Employee Resource Groups: Support the creation of groups that allow employees to connect over shared backgrounds or interests, fostering a sense of belonging.
- Set Diversity Goals: Establish clear diversity and inclusion objectives, and hold management accountable for meeting these goals.
Challenges of Implementing Workplace Diversity
While workplace diversity offers numerous benefits, organizations may face challenges such as:
- Resistance to Change: Existing employees might be resistant to new policies focused on inclusion.
- Unconscious Bias: Employees may hold biases that unintentionally affect their interactions with colleagues.
- Lack of Resources: Organizations may struggle to allocate the time and resources needed to effectively promote diversity and inclusion.
